Captain Cook sighting the Glasshouse Mountains, 1770, (Queensland, Australia, 1886). Wood engraving from Picturesque Atlas of Australasia, Vol II, by Andrew Garran, illustrated under the supervision of Frederic B Schell, (Picturesque Atlas Publishing Co, 1886)

EDITORS COMMENTS
The captivating print captures the historic moment when Captain James Cook first sighted the majestic Glasshouse Mountains in Queensland, Australia in 1770. Created by renowned artist Julian Ashton and featured in the Picturesque Atlas of Australasia, this wood engraving from 1886 transports us back to a time of exploration and discovery. In this monochrome image, we see a sailing ship anchored off the coast as Captain Cook stands on its deck, gazing at the breathtaking mountain range before him. The mountains rise dramatically from the landscape, their peaks shrouded in mist. The engraving beautifully depicts both the ruggedness and serenity of this Australian geographical feature. Ashton's attention to detail brings life to every element of this scene - from the intricately crafted ship to the vast expanse of water that separates it from land. The print evokes a sense of adventure and curiosity that defined Captain Cook's voyages during the 18th century.
